Output d8656ecc2f6ae3a66d5b8079ef7039ac3a3493abb11ee22dcc7f0bbfd404b2fd:6

value
643245277
script pubkey
OP_0 OP_PUSHBYTES_20 9c224e1a23bcb1e6814ab9fb67237c87a1145854
address
bc1qns3yux3rhjc7dq22h8akwgmus7s3gkz5r8cls9
transaction
d8656ecc2f6ae3a66d5b8079ef7039ac3a3493abb11ee22dcc7f0bbfd404b2fd
confirmations
1623
spent
true